Text, frame, and reference-guided generation

Use text-to-video for scenes defined in words. Image-to-video preserves a supplied opening composition, while the Fast route can also accept an optional final frame. Fast reference-to-video uses up to 4 images to guide identity, style, or composition. Choose Standard for final fidelity and Fast for quicker iteration.

Landscape, portrait, and API delivery

Generate 16:9 for cinematic and desktop placements or 9:16 for vertical social formats. All current routes accept 8 seconds. Test inputs in the Playground, submit the matching API request, poll its task ID, and retrieve the video URL after success.

What is Veo 3.1?

Veo 3.1 is Google's AI video model for cinematic short-form video with prompt-directed motion and native audio. sjolt provides an interactive generator and task API.

What is the difference between Veo 3.1 Standard and Fast?

Choose Standard for final visual fidelity and Fast for quicker prompt, frame, and reference-image iteration.

Which Veo 3.1 generation routes are available?

sjolt provides Standard and Fast text-to-video, Standard and Fast image-to-video, and Fast reference-to-video, each with a matching API endpoint.

How do start frames, end frames, and reference images work?

Image-to-video requires a start image. Fast image-to-video may also use an end image. Fast reference-to-video accepts up to 4 images for identity, style, materials, and composition guidance.

Can Veo 3.1 generate audio with the video?

Yes. Prompts can direct dialogue, ambience, and effects with the visual action. Describe each sound source and timing clearly.

How should I write a Veo 3.1 prompt?

Describe subject, action, setting, camera, lighting, style, and audio in sequence. Explicitly exclude unwanted text, subtitles, logos, or watermarks.

Which duration and aspect ratios does sjolt support?

All current Veo 3.1 routes accept a 8-second duration. Choose 16:9 for landscape delivery or 9:16 for vertical video.

How does the Veo 3.1 API workflow work?

Submit a route with its prompt and required media. Poll the returned task ID, then read the generated video URL from a successful response.
